How to Say ‘A quiet table’ in Mexican Spanish
Una mesa tranquila
OO-nah MEH-sah trahn-KEE-lah
[OO-nah MEH-sah trahn-KEE-lah]
Phrase Breakdown
Una
[OO-nah]
a; one
Feminine singular article used with "mesa."
Una mesa para cuatro, por favor.
A table for four, please.
mesa
[MEH-sah]
table
A place to sit in the restaurant.
Una mesa cerca de la entrada no nos conviene.
A table near the entrance does not suit us.
tranquila
[trahn-KEE-lah]
quiet; शांत?
Describes a calm table location with less noise; useful for a special seating request.
Preferimos una zona tranquila para conversar.
We prefer a quiet area to talk.
